This is a common issue with many ships that have elevators. And although the issue can be played around on other ships by taking alternative paths like ladders/stairs/ramps, it's particularly egregious on the Syulen, because that elevator is the only way to move through the ship.
It's quite a shame too, since the Syulen is otherwise a pretty great ship. But this bug is the main reason I chose to melt mine, since I couldn't do any planetside missions at all. It's sad to hear that it still hasn't been fixed![]()

As a person who has dealt with server code and has already made more than 5 projects (games), I have always said that server meshing is a fiction because it contradicts the basics. No matter how many servers you add (for location), in the end everything comes down to one database that is processed by one server. All your servers ultimately knock on one window. And if your database is overloaded, adding servers that will only increase the load on this database will not help you in any way. And I have been saying and writing this for more than 6 years. The fact is that synchronizing the work of this entire network of servers takes up more resources than adding a new server gives.
A secret that everyone knows except players and fans. Do you know why the flight speed was reduced? This allowed us to reduce the tick rate and the load on the main server, which allowed us to expand from 150 to 600 people. This is the whole reason for MASTER MOD! Reduce the tick rate and load.
Those who played EVE know that under heavy loads the speed of all players slows down (for them it looks like time dilation). For this task the master mod was made.
